Brits Secure Sailing Medal

Sailing: Simon Hiscocks and Chris Draper have guaranteed a medal in the mixed 49er class with one race remaining.
Simon Hiscocks and Chris Draper have today guaranteed Great Britain their fourth sailing medal of the Games.

The British pair finished a punishing day's mixed 49er sailing in third place overall and, with just one race remaining, cannot be caught by America, who are currently fourth.

The duo won the first race of the day this morning, came ninth in the second, and cruised to sixth in the third race.

Hiscocks and Draper are in with a shout of gold too, though it would mean victory in the sixteenth and final race on Thursday and current leaders Spain finishing 12th or lower.

Though that might be unlikely, they do stand a definite chance of silver with the Ukraine crew only two points ahead in second place.
